Care and Maintenance
To keep this Fire Opal looking its best, it's important to maintain it properly. Avoid exposure to harsh chemicals or extreme temperatures. Clean the gemstone by gently wiping it with a soft cloth and store it in a padded compartment of your jewelry box to prevent scratches.
